README.fips.md
# MinIO FIPS Builds MinIO creates FIPS builds using a patched version of the Go compiler (that uses BoringCrypto, from BoringSSL, which is [FIPS 140-2 validated](https://csrc.nist.gov/csrc/media/projects/cryptographic-module-validation-program/documents/security-policies/140sp2964.pdf)) published by the Golang Team [here](https://github.com/golang/go/tree/dev.boringcrypto/misc/boring).

platforms/documentation/docs/src/samples/build-organization/composite-builds/basic/README.adoc
== Defining and using a composite build This sample shows how 2 Gradle builds that are normally developed separately and combined using binary integration can be wired together into a composite build with source integration. The `my-utils` multiproject build produces 2 different java libraries, and the `my-app` build produces an executable using functions from those libraries.
